About Raghav Gupta

Raghav Gupta is a scholar working on Surgery, Pulmonary and Respiratory Medicine, Cardiology and Cardiovascular Medicine, Epidemiology and Oncology, having authored 68 papers that have together received 363 indexed citations. Recurring topics across this work include Palliative Care and End-of-Life Issues (6 papers), COVID-19 and healthcare impacts (4 papers), Infective Endocarditis Diagnosis and Management (3 papers), Peripheral Artery Disease Management (3 papers), Cardiac Imaging and Diagnostics (3 papers), Cardiac electrophysiology and arrhythmias (2 papers), Cardiac, Anesthesia and Surgical Outcomes (2 papers) and Hepatitis B Virus Studies (2 papers). The work is most often cited by research in Hepatology (32 citations), Epidemiology (112 citations), Cardiology and Cardiovascular Medicine (67 citations), Internal Medicine (10 citations) and Infectious Diseases (34 citations). Raghav Gupta has collaborated with scholars based in India, United States and Canada. Frequent co-authors include Thomas A. Hennebry, Siddharth A. Wayangankar, Ira N. Targoff, Gregg L Ruppel, Joseph Espiritu, D. C. Jain, Ashim K. Datta, Jorge F. Saucedo, J Singh and Durlav Prasad Bora. Their work appears in journals such as PLoS ONE, Catheterization and Cardiovascular Interventions, The American Journal of Cardiology, Neurological Sciences and Respiratory Care.
